Output 40d7524716c6719103888d343dddf57ddf74ed3032ab10b2e66e60a89d6feec3:6

value
29101933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14f32d0db3c96510273128b205cd464e8c1cafe5 OP_EQUAL
address
M9ow4RwWgQyQjgsDkNcWJ9CkmF2XjbLPvu
transaction
40d7524716c6719103888d343dddf57ddf74ed3032ab10b2e66e60a89d6feec3
spent
true